    • HEARING AID MICROPHONE PROTECTIVE BARRIER

    • Embodiments of the invention provide microphone assemblies for hearing aids which are resistant to moisture and debris. An embodiment provides a microphone assembly for a CIC hearing aid comprising a microphone housing including a housing surface having a microphone port, a fluidic barrier structure coupled to the housing surface, a protective mesh coupled to the barrier structure and a microphone disposed within the housing. The microphone housing can be sized to be positioned in close proximity to another component surface such as a hearing battery assembly surface. At least a portion of the housing surface and/or the barrier structure are hydrophobic. The barrier structure surrounds the microphone port and is configured to channel liquid and debris away from entry into the microphone port including matter constrained between the housing surface and another surface.
    • 本发明的实施例提供了耐潮湿和碎屑的助听器的麦克风组件。 实施例提供了一种用于CIC助听器的麦克风组件,其包括麦克风壳体,该麦克风壳体包括具有麦克风端口的壳体表面,耦合到壳体表面的流体阻挡结构,耦合到阻挡结构的保护网和设置在壳体内的麦克风。 麦克风壳体的尺寸可以被定位成紧邻另一组件表面,例如听力电池组件表面。 壳体表面和/或阻挡结构的至少一部分是疏水性的。 阻挡结构围绕麦克风端口并且被配置为将液体和碎屑引导进入麦克风端口,包括限制在壳体表面和另一表面之间的物质。
